Latest Patents
Morris’s most recent patents include a multi-stage pump powered by integral canned motors and a two-stage submersible propulsor unit for water vehicles. The multi-stage pump is specifically designed to boost efficiency and reliability, featuring multiple pump units that operate in series to increase the pressure of pumped fluids. Each unit comprises a hollow housing with a hermetically sealed stator and an impeller assembly that utilizes a rotating rotor to convey fluids effectively. This design not only optimizes the pumping process but also ensures the integrity of the motor's components.
The two-stage submersible propulsor unit showcases Morris's ingenuity in water vehicle technology. This invention incorporates a shroud with designated water inlets and outlets, housing both an upstream and downstream propeller that operate independently via separate electric motors. This setup prevents interference with water flow, minimizing noise and enhancing performance, while maintaining the overall efficiency of the propulsion system.
